build: allow use of BUILDFLAG directives from within JS code (#20328)

This commit is contained in:
Milan Burda 2020-05-11 01:06:07 +02:00 committed by GitHub
parent f9c04449f4
commit 392ea320cf
No known key found for this signature in database
GPG key ID: 4AEE18F83AFDEB23
16 changed files with 132 additions and 74 deletions

View file

@ -1,5 +1,11 @@
declare var internalBinding: any;
declare const BUILDFLAG: (flag: boolean) => boolean;
declare const ENABLE_DESKTOP_CAPTURER: boolean;
declare const ENABLE_REMOTE_MODULE: boolean;
declare const ENABLE_VIEWS_API: boolean;
declare namespace NodeJS {
interface FeaturesBinding {
isBuiltinSpellCheckerEnabled(): boolean;